JVM-Kurzeinführung
# 🎜🎜#
Speicherung lokaler Variablen im Speicher: Referenz verweist nicht auf die Objektschreibmethode: #🎜 🎜#Diese Referenz zeigt nicht auf ein Objekt
Kann ein Referenzpunkt sein auf mehrere Objekte gleichzeitig?
Für diesen Code kann er nur auf ein Objekt verweisen und die Adresse eines Objekts speichern. Am Ende wird nur die Adresse des letzten Objekts gespeichert
Der Prozess der Übergabe des Arrays als Parameter der Methode:
Lösungsdruckergebnis:
Die ersten beiden Lösungen:
fun2 Ergebnis drucken:
# 🎜🎜#Analysebeispiel: Was stellt das folgende Bild dar? array2 zeigt auf das Objekt, auf das die Referenz von array1 zeigt.
Das Bild unten stellt die Bedeutung des obigen Beispiels dar: Anmerkungen: Zitat Es ist falsch, auf eine Referenz zu verweisen. Befindet sich die Referenz unbedingt auf dem Stapel?Nicht unbedingt, ob sich eine Variable auf dem Stapel befindet, hängt von der Art Ihrer Variablen ab. Wenn es sich um eine lokale Variable handelt, muss sie sich auf dem Stapel befinden. Wenn nicht, befinden sich Instanz-Membervariablen beispielsweise nicht unbedingt auf dem Stapel.
Das obige ist der detaillierte Inhalt vonSo verwenden Sie ein Array als Parameter einer Methode in Java.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!